Abstract:
[Problem] To provide an optical transmission device which realizes the flexibility of optical communication such as wavelength reutilization while suppressing the band constriction of an optical filter, and which supports a flexible grid. [Solution] An optical transmission device according to the present invention is provided with a cyclic Arrayed Waveguide Grating (AWG) for filtering each optical signal inputted to each input port. Each of the optical signals is constituted so that a plurality of wavelength-multiplexed signals can be allocated within one channel band, each of the optical signals being filtered in channel units, and the pass-band width of each of the input ports of the cyclic AWG corresponds to the channel bandwidth.
